The Germany precision zero-drift operational amplifier market exhibits a robust application in the automotive sector, driven by the increasing demand for advanced automotive electronics. Zero-drift operational amplifiers are pivotal in enhancing the accuracy of sensor systems and control units in vehicles. These amplifiers contribute to precision in managing electronic stability control systems, adaptive cruise control, and advanced driver-assistance systems (ADAS). By minimizing drift and offset errors, they ensure reliable performance and safety features in modern vehicles. As automotive technology evolves, the integration of zero-drift op-amps is becoming essential for meeting stringent performance and reliability standards, promoting greater adoption in the automotive industry.
In the industrial sector, precision zero-drift operational amplifiers are integral to automation and process control applications. These amplifiers are employed in instrumentation systems that require high accuracy and stability, such as temperature sensors, pressure sensors, and data acquisition systems. The zero-drift characteristics of these amplifiers reduce measurement errors and enhance the precision of control processes. Their use in industrial environments facilitates more accurate monitoring and control of manufacturing processes, contributing to improved efficiency and product quality. The growing trend towards automation and the need for reliable data in industrial applications are driving the demand for zero-drift op-amps in this sector.
The medical sector also benefits significantly from the use of precision zero-drift operational amplifiers, where accuracy and stability are critical. These amplifiers are used in various medical devices, including diagnostic equipment, patient monitoring systems, and imaging systems. The ability to maintain performance without drift ensures precise readings and reliable operation of medical instruments, which is crucial for patient safety and effective treatment. As medical technology advances and the demand for high-precision diagnostics grows, zero-drift op-amps are becoming increasingly essential. Their role in enhancing the reliability and accuracy of medical devices underscores their importance in the healthcare industry.

A precision zero-drift Op-Amp is a type of operational amplifier that provides very high accuracy and stability over time and temperature.
Some key features include low offset voltage, low offset drift, high common-mode rejection ratio, and low noise.
These Op-Amps are commonly used in precision instrumentation, sensor interfaces, and other high-accuracy analog circuits.
